Against Sleep And Nightmare magazine has been in print for quite a few years now. We originally put the text on the Web to making its text more widely available and this has been successful - this site was getting 4,000 hits per week in early 2003. This site contains a few other "ultra-left" texts as well but these are slowly being phased out. Virtually everyone has access to web presently and so there is no reason to reproduce things that are likely available elsewhere.

There are important issues involved in placing texts in electronic form rather than printed form. As the web has developed, we seen that the main danger is confusion rather than simple conditioning a la television. The web is still ironically something of the last hold-out to capital's totalitarian voice. To make these text available to those who might use them as quickly as possible, we will delay fully addressing how to deal with the information system (see also article The Information Age).

ASAN has evolved considerably since it was first published. We suggest reading the most recent issue first. For that reason, we list the back-issue's last to first.
